Departamento de Economía, AB Using data on the Spanish firm-level production network we show that firmslearn about international trade opportunities and related business know-how from their production network peers. Our identification strategy leverages the panel structure of the data, import origin variation, and network structure. We find evidence of both upstream and downstream network effects, even after accounting for sectoral and geographical spillovers. Larger firms are better at absorbing valuable information but worse at disseminating it. Connections with geographically distant firms provide more useful information to start importing.
